Transaction 37caf38774742d6b340796e185f855662c9423f05dac9c90cbf12c9c21318534

1 Input
2 Outputs
  • 37caf38774742d6b340796e185f855662c9423f05dac9c90cbf12c9c21318534:0
  • value  8850433046
    address  2NFPMPYtA1CrAihVAqo4emWXL4EuHgFyjMj
  • 37caf38774742d6b340796e185f855662c9423f05dac9c90cbf12c9c21318534:1
  • value  1937017
    address  2NE1QhWjVv7KFppjaP3tYKj7NvApF5kVBLB